Salary by State: Computer and Information Research Scientists vs Computer Occupations, All Other
Showing 42 states where both occupations have BLS data. Computer and Information Research Scientists pays more in 38 states; Computer Occupations, All Other pays more in 4.
| State | Computer and Information Research Scientists | Computer Occupations, All Other | Difference | ||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Alabama | $102,250 | $96,620 | +$5,630 | ||
| Arizona | $134,910 | $96,280 | +$38,630 | ||
| California | $175,530 | $123,570 | +$51,960 | ||
| Colorado | $126,840 | $116,380 | +$10,460 | ||
| Connecticut | $112,580 | $102,380 | +$10,200 | ||
| District of Columbia | $145,780 | $131,980 | +$13,800 | ||
| Florida | $118,190 | $98,420 | +$19,770 | ||
| Georgia | $83,600 | $94,270 | $-10,670 | ||
| Hawaii | $133,160 | $105,680 | +$27,480 | ||
| Idaho | $163,660 | $98,390 | +$65,270 | ||
| Illinois | $116,450 | $110,160 | +$6,290 | ||
| Indiana | $82,360 | $94,720 | $-12,360 | ||
| Iowa | $110,510 | $97,090 | +$13,420 | ||
| Kansas | $104,690 | $91,100 | +$13,590 | ||
| Kentucky | $116,250 | $85,570 | +$30,680 | ||
| Louisiana | $112,110 | $76,100 | +$36,010 | ||
| Maryland | $145,600 | $135,740 | +$9,860 | ||
| Massachusetts | $170,020 | $111,640 | +$58,380 | ||
| Michigan | $112,330 | $96,620 | +$15,710 | ||
| Minnesota | $116,810 | $99,620 | +$17,190 | ||
| Mississippi | $111,110 | $82,830 | +$28,280 | ||
| Missouri | $108,380 | $89,680 | +$18,700 | ||
| Nebraska | $101,990 | $83,450 | +$18,540 | ||
| Nevada | $126,840 | $99,060 | +$27,780 | ||
| New Hampshire | $131,540 | $89,990 | +$41,550 | ||
| New Jersey | $129,950 | $94,810 | +$35,140 | ||
| New Mexico | $172,190 | $94,990 | +$77,200 | ||
| New York | $151,470 | $102,910 | +$48,560 | ||
| North Carolina | $105,180 | $83,840 | +$21,340 | ||
| Ohio | $123,010 | $103,460 | +$19,550 | ||
| Oklahoma | $90,600 | $91,100 | $-500 | ||
| Oregon | $160,140 | $91,680 | +$68,460 | ||
| Pennsylvania | $118,870 | $101,710 | +$17,160 | ||
| Rhode Island | $122,030 | $91,940 | +$30,090 | ||
| South Carolina | $114,400 | $104,920 | +$9,480 | ||
| Tennessee | $120,090 | $64,450 | +$55,640 | ||
| Texas | $129,690 | $100,720 | +$28,970 | ||
| Utah | $88,610 | $93,870 | $-5,260 | ||
| Virginia | $143,750 | $128,020 | +$15,730 | ||
| Washington | $218,180 | $128,200 | +$89,980 | ||
| West Virginia | $167,480 | $104,920 | +$62,560 | ||
| Wisconsin | $150,700 | $81,660 | +$69,040 |
Frequently Asked Questions
Who makes more: Computer and Information Research Scientists or Computer Occupations, All Other?
On average across all states, a Computer and Information Research Scientists earns more than a Computer Occupations, All Other. The national median salary difference is $29,929 (30.6%) based on 2024 BLS data.
In how many states does a Computer and Information Research Scientists earn more than a Computer Occupations, All Other?
A Computer and Information Research Scientists earns a higher median salary than a Computer Occupations, All Other in 38 out of 42 states where both occupations have BLS data. A Computer Occupations, All Other pays more in 4 states.
What is the median salary for a Computer and Information Research Scientists vs Computer Occupations, All Other?
The national median salary for a Computer and Information Research Scientists is $127,853 per year, compared to $97,924 for a Computer Occupations, All Other, according to 2024 BLS OEWS data.
Which has more jobs: Computer and Information Research Scientists or Computer Occupations, All Other?
There are more people employed as Computer Occupations, All Other. BLS reports approximately 28,930 Computer and Information Research Scientists positions and 412,730 Computer Occupations, All Other positions nationwide (2024).
